Attention: Doomed races of Earth

RPM '07 champions (and your future overlords) Frederick E. Slidepole and the Bugs Who Took Over The World will not be creating an album this year.  In their temporary absence, it is up to you to attempt to fill the void whilst simultaneously earning a chance to save yourselves from otherwise certain peril.

Here's how:

Option 1: Write and record a song extolling the virtues of Frederick E. Slidepole and/or The Bugs Who Took Over The World.  It will be judged.

  • If Frederick Slidepole likes it, you will be spared, joining the ranks of Joshua Wentz who betrayed humanity by collaborating with Frederick on the song "On Your Left (You'll Notice Bugs Taking Over The World)" last year. For this, Mr. Wentz shall be spared and awarded a terrible job lifting heavy boxes for as long as he lives. That sounds bad, but considers the alternative: (cf.  "Cnidophobic to the Max")
  • If Frederick is not impressed (more than likely for not grovelling hard enough), you will still be granted mercy for one year and one day simply for your effort. After such time, you must find some other means of achieving safety for when the coup d'splat begins.

Option 2: If you are already certain you cannot be awarded lifelong amnesty as described above, you may still secure yourself for one year and one day by dedicating one of your current RPM songs to FESATBWTOTW by simply naming either Frederick E. Slidepole or The Bugs Who Took Over The World in your song title.

The chosen one:
The writer of Frederick's favourite song submitted will be awarded an autographed copy of the CD, Meet the Beetles and the Aphids and the Daddy Long Legs and the Mosquitoes and the Dragonflies and the Fruit Flies and the Deer Ticks and the Carpenter Ants and the Cicadas and all of their Friends.  This one-of-a-kind album will also contain a bonus track!! recorded exclusively for the winner.  It will not be publicly released.  It will be for the chosen one, after all.

The scorned one:
The writer of Frederick's most despised song will be visited by a plague of locusts and also be the subject of his ire in at least one song during RPM Challenge '09.

Post your songs in this forum thread: Glorify Frederick E. Slidepole Here.  If you have any questions, Mr. Slidepole might answer them there. Or, the asker may be smitten. Possibly both.
